DES RESSOURCES ET DES OUTILS AU SERVICE DES ACTEURS ET DES PROFESSIONNELS.

Javascript

Date de mise à jour : 04/12/2025 | Identifiant OffreInfo : 15_522278

Information fournie par :
Carif-Oref Occitanie

Objectifs, programme, validation de la formation

Objectifs

Connaître le langage Javascript afin de développer des pages Web interactives et réactives.

Programme de la formation

- Présentation de Javascript

  • Histoire du langage
  • Les versions de Javascript, Jscript, ECMAScript
  • Environnements d'utilisation de Javascript

- Bases du langage JavaScript
  • Les variables et leur portée
  • Types fournis par Javascript
  • Les opérateurs et structures de contrôle
  • « Objets » fournis par le langage
  • Définition de fonctions, arguments
  • Outils de débogage (navigateurs et IDE)
  • JavaScript Object Notation (JSON)
  • Documentations en ligne

- Particularités de Javascript
  • Prototypes vs objets
  • Fonctions anonymes, fonctions flèches et fermetures
  • Ajout de membres aux prototypes de base
  • Fonctions ayant valeur de constructeur

- Javascript dans le contexte du navigateur
  • Incompatibilités historiques entre navigateurs
  • BOM et DOM
  • API Javascript HTML 5

- Événements DOM
  • Réaction à un événement
  • Principaux événements du DOM
  • Bouillonnement, propagation, délégation, interruption d'événements

- Javascript et asynchronisme
  • Principe de l'asynchronisme en Javascript
  • Les fonctions de rappel
  • Cas d'usage de l'asynchronisme : requêtes AJAX
  • L'enfer des callbacks
  • Gestion de l'asynchronisme via les promesses
  • Gestion de l'asynchronisme via les fonctions asynchrones

- Écosystème Javascript
  • Environnement d'exécution node.js
  • Évocation et comparaison de différents Framework Javascript : jQuery, Bootstrap, Angular, React, Vue.js, RxJS

Validation et sanction

Attestation de formation

Type de formation

Non certificiante

Sortie

Sans niveau spécifique

Métiers visés

Code Rome

Durée, rythme, financement

Modalités pédagogiques
Durée
21 heures en centre

Conventionnement : Non

Financeur(s)

Autre

Conditions d'accès

Public(s)
Tout public
Modalités de recrutement et d'admission

Niveau d'entrée : Sans niveau spécifique

Conditions spécifiques et prérequis

Pour suivre ce stage dans de bonnes conditions, il est recommandé d'avoir suivi en amont les formations "HTML5" et "CSS3" ou d'avoir atteint par la pratique un niveau équivalent\n\nProcédure d'admission: \nUn formulaire d'auto-évaluation proposé en amont de la formation nous permettra d'évaluer votre niveau et de recueillir vos attentes. Ce même formulaire soumis en aval de la formation fournira une appréciation de votre progression.Des exercices pratiques seront proposés à la fin de chaque séquence pédagogique pour l'évaluation des acquis.En fin de formation, vous serez amené(e) à renseigner un questionnaire d'évaluation à chaud.Une attestation de formation vous sera adressée à l'issue de la session.Trois mois après votre formation, vous recevrez par email un formulaire d'évaluation à froid sur l'utilisation des acquis de la formation.

Modalités d'accès

Lieu de réalisation de l'action

formation entièrement présentielle
Adresse
41 rue de la Découverte
CS 37623
31676 - Labège
Responsable : Data Value
Téléphone fixe :
Contacter l'organisme

Contacts

Contact sur la formation
41 rue de la Découverte
CS 37621
31676 - Labège
Responsable : Monsieur Cédric CALAS
Téléphone fixe : 0972567567
fax :
Site web :
Contacter l'organisme
Contacter l'organisme formateur
Data Value
SIRET: 81837224500014
31676 Labège
Responsable :
Téléphone fixe :
Site web :
Contacter l'organisme

Période prévisibles de déroulement des sessions

du 25/11/2026 au 27/11/2026
débutant le : 25/11/2026
Adresse d'inscription
41 rue de la Découverte
31676 - Labège
Etat du recrutement : Ouvert
Modalités : Entrées / Sorties à dates fixes

Organisme responsable

Data Value
SIRET : 81837224500014

Adresse
41 rue de la Découverte
CS 37621
31676 - Labège
Téléphone fixe : 0972567567
Contacter l'organisme